(1) Study the House Edge of the Game You’re Playing

If you don’t know what house edge is, don’t feel bad. Most casino players don’t, and that’s why most gamblers don’t win.

House edge is the mathematical advantage which casinos have. It means that no matter how many players win, the casino still makes money on a long enough timeline. It is a mathematical certainty that the casino will make money because of the house edge.

Each casino game has a different house edge. We’ve written a full guide to casino house edge, so there’s no need to get into each game again here. However, we can tell you that blackjack has the lowest house edge, and keno has the highest house edge.

We strongly advise that you study casino house edge before playing any casino games. Taking the time to do so could be the difference between winning a losing. It’s also important to look at the different variants of the games (if applicable). For example, did you know that the house edge of European roulette is much smaller than that of American roulette?

(3) Play With Strategies When Possible

There are some casino games which strategies don’t help much with. Slot machines and keno are two of them. Sure, you can have a strategy to help you manage your bankroll, but these are games of pure chance, and so most strategies are ineffective.

There are games in which strategies can have a great effect, though. Blackjack and poker are two which immediately spring to mind. If you use a flawless blackjack strategy (use a cheat sheet if necessary) you could bring the house edge down to a tiny 0.5%.

First, you’ll need to figure out which games you can win with casino strategies. After that, you’ll have to figure out which strategies work.

(5) Have a Plan for Your Bankroll

Whether you have a budget of $20 or $20,000 to play with, think about what you’re going to do before you begin playing. Casino games can arouse strong emotions, so it can help to write your plan down and refer to it often as gameplay continues.

For example, you could divide your bankroll into 1% lots, and refuse to risk more than that on any hand of cards or spin of the reels or roulette wheel. This means that your bankroll will last longer, but it doesn’t necessarily increase your chances of winning (that’s more to do with the games you play).

You could also plan to use certain percentages of your bankroll on different games. For example, you could say that you’ll use your free spins on a low volatility slot like Starburst to give you the best chance of meeting wagering requirements. Alternatively, you could say that after your first big win on a slot machine, you’ll switch to blackjack and grind it out until you have doubled that win.
